What is AI autofocus, and how does it improve Nikon cameras?

AI autofocus uses artificial intelligence to track and predict the movement of subjects. This results in faster and more accurate autofocus, even in dynamic or challenging conditions.

Can I use my old Nikon lenses with the 2026 models?

Yes, Nikon’s F-mount lenses are compatible with the D2026 DSLR. For mirrorless models like the Z9 Mark II, you may need an adapter to use F-mount lenses.
